Lemuel A. S. “Sam” Hill, 77, of Buda died on Tuesday, February 8, 2022, at OSF St Francis in Peoria. Memorial visitation will be held on Saturday, Feb. 12th from 1:00 p.m. to 5:00 p.m. at the Bureau County Metro Center in Princeton with special military honors at 2:00 p.m. Cremation rites have been accorded. Stackhouse-Moore Funeral & Cremation Services, Sheffield is assisting the family. In lieu of flowers memorials may be made to Navy & Marine Corps Relief Society 875 N. Randolph St. Suite 225, Arlington, VA 22203 or to Peaceful Piggy Rehabilitation Sanctuary, 11596 Twp. Hwy 44, Upper Sandusky, Ohio, 43351.
Sam was born on November 10, 1944, in Chattanooga, TN. He was a career military serving in the U.S. Navy from 1965 until 1986. During his career, he served in many places and had served in recovery missions for the space shuttle disasters. On February 19, 1977, he married Linda Rydberg in Chicago.
Sam was a member of the Kewanee American Legion Post. He enjoyed camping, and loved fishing and spending time with his grandchildren and great-grandson. He also enjoyed western and classic TV.
Survivors include his wife Linda; two children, Dawn (Greg) Webb, Sheffield, and Daniel Hill, Buda; grandchildren Sabrina and Ethen Webb and great-grandson, Bryson Primo. He is also survived by several brothers-in-law, sisters-in-law, nieces, and nephews.
